The flowers of mints, basil, oregano, thyme, dill, chervil, cilantro, rosemary, savory, and sage can add … Web22 aug. 2024 · Tips for growing Jasminum Sambac. Where to plant – This edible type of flower also loves sunlight, so planting it in a sunny spot is a great choice. You can plant it alongside fences. The flowers attract butterflies. WebList of Edible Flowers: 1. Red Clover (Trifolium pratense) This plant is mostly used for medicinal purposes, and the leaves are usually dried and used to make tea. But the tastiest part is actually the flower. Toss them in salads for taste and color, or eat them with fruits and cheeses. 2. WebBoth the fresh leaves and flowers are edible.
